Landau Forte Charitable Trust is a family of six Primary, Secondary
and Sixth Form Academies across the Midlands. Established in 1989, our roots as
a charity lie in the global finance and hospitality industries, with our
founders Martin Landau and Rocco Forte. Their values combine in how our schools
look after their children and young people; they aspire to a world-leading
standard of innovation, entrepreneurship, service and care.
We believe a brilliant education should be central to the
development of every child and young person. Their learning, wellbeing and
happiness is at the centre of every decision we take and every pound we
spend.
Landau Forte Academy QEMS joined the Landau Forte Charitable Trust in
September 2011 and delivers education to 11-16 year olds. Landau Forte Academy
Sixth Form is a purpose-built establishment providing Level 3 courses, both
Advanced Level and Applied qualifications, for the whole of Tamworth and
beyond. The academies are located on a shared campus, but both operate from
their own facilities. Both QEMS and
Tamworth Sixth Form are oversubscribed.

Tamworth is a historic town surrounded by beautiful countryside,
located a short distance from Birmingham. The Academy is located close to the
centre of Tamworth, with superb transport links. Tamworth boasts a range of
historical sites and leisure attractions, including: Tamworth Castle; the
Tamworth SnowDome and Drayton Manor Amusement Park. Within a 20 minute drive
from the town, you can find yourself in the beautiful, open Staffordshire countryside
or Birmingham‘s bustling city centre.
